The application to the International PhD Course in Cognitive and Behavioral Sciences can be submitted, regardless of age or citizenship, by those holding a 5-year University Degree, a Master Degree or an equivalent foreign academic qualification, approved by the PhD Examination Committee, also according to international agreements on the recognition of qualifications for the continuation of studies.
Last year Master’s degree students can also apply to the PhD Course only if they will graduate before October 31st, 2023.
